Following increased rumours of a move to Bayern Munich, Nadiem Amiri has signed a new two-year deal with TSG 1899 Hoffenheim.
Amiri: “I would of course like to repay the faith shown in me. That’s my goal. TSG has become a bit like a home for me. I know exactly what I have at TSG and I’m sure I can continue to develop, particularly with the upcoming international challenges.”
Julian Nagelsmann: “He’s a special player, because he can go from our youth academy to become a high-performing young professional. His development is far from complete, and it’s great to be able to actively support Nadiem along his career path.”
The 20-year-old’s deal now ends in 2020, after signing for the club as a 15-year-old in 2012. Amiri was a key protagonist in helping Hoffenheim qualify for the Champions League for the first time in their history.
